Until 30 November 2019, the Call for Entries for the 2019 Shenzhen Design Award for Young Talents (SDAY) is open.

For its 4th edition, SDAY invites design professionals or students aged 35 or younger of the 180 UNESCO Creative Cities to submit their work on the theme of Inclusive Design.

SDAY aims to encourage young talented designers for their contribution to the development of cities around the world. The purpose of SDAY is to reward the efforts of young designers, who, through their creativity, have contributed to the enhancement of environmental sustainability, social and economic development and, above all, quality of lives in cities. The Award stimulates exchange between young talents from different countries, cooperation between creative cities, and the sharing of experiences and ideas for developing creative and cultural industries. The Award also promotes the value of design thinking, concepts and products as contributors to the transformation of economies and society.

Launched in 2013, SDAY hopes to encourage young creatives via international and local activities such as tour of exhibitions, workshops, talks and forums, etc. The platform offers designers and design studios the opportunity to learn, communicate, and network with like-minded talents across borders.

This year’s theme of Inclusive Design reflects this era flooded with commodities and over-consumption, where new ethical standards ask for inclusive design. Respecting individual differences, satisfying the needs of the populations, and attaching equal importance to the functions and emotional values of objects are the new aesthetic standards that the era has asked of design. The rise of sciences and technologies, the diversity of culture, the emergence of new forces, and the turbulence in international politics and economies form the context in which designers are called to keep broad visions and open minds. With the integration of disciplines and the sharing of skills, designers shoulder the important mission of providing new perspectives for the public and providing new ideas for solving challenges and contradictions. Only when design becomes inclusive can it create a better future for all.

SDAY has 21 awards: 1 Grand Award (professional Group), 10 Merit Awards (professional Group), 10 New Star Awards (Student Group), and 3 Best Nominator honorary prize.

Online registration and submission is open from 9 September 2019 and will close at 6.00 p.m. on 30 November 2019 (Beijing Time, GMT+08:00).

Final judging is scheduled in December 2019 and the Award Ceremony will be held in April 2020.
